Pharmacokinetics And Relative Bioavailability Of Bococizumab (PF-04950615; RN316) When Administered To The Abdomen, Thigh Or Upper Arm
RandomizedParallel-groupOpen-labelBasic science
Summary
This study aims to characterize the single dose pharmacokinetics of PF-04950616 following subcutaneous injection to the abdomen, upper arm or the thigh.
